Cod: Rigol DS1000CA DS1062CA DS1102CA DS1202CA DS1302CA
Descriere
DS1062CA 2-Channel, 60MHz Bandwidth, 2GS/s Sample Rate, 10Kpts Memory
DS1102CA 2-Channel, 100MHz Bandwidth, 2GS/s Sample Rate, 10Kpts Memory
DS1202CA 2-Channel, 200MHz Bandwidth, 2GS/s Sample Rate, 10Kpts Memory
DS1302CA 2-Channel, 300MHz Bandwidth, 2GS/s Sample Rate, 10Kpts Memory
